[hibernate-commits] [hibernate/hibernate-search] a1fa6b: HSEARCH-3673 Align the examples of the javadoc on ...

Yoann Rodière noreply at github.com
Fri Sep 13 04:46:44 EDT 2019


  Branch: refs/heads/master
  Home:   https://github.com/hibernate/hibernate-search
  Commit: a1fa6bdc170909c2bbb7421a20e33abc15737912
      https://github.com/hibernate/hibernate-search/commit/a1fa6bdc170909c2bbb7421a20e33abc15737912
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M engine/src/main/java/org/hibernate/search/engine/backend/document/model/dsl/ObjectFieldStorage.java
    M mapper/pojo/src/main/java/org/hibernate/search/mapper/pojo/mapping/definition/annotation/IndexedEmbedded.java

  Log Message:
  -----------
  HSEARCH-3673 Align the examples of the javadoc on the common Book/Author model used in the reference documentation


  Commit: c2cbcdcaf7d1587c133793877aa5fd08ebfdf80c
      https://github.com/hibernate/hibernate-search/commit/c2cbcdcaf7d1587c133793877aa5fd08ebfdf80c
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c

  Log Message:
  -----------
  HSEARCH-3679 Add an (empty) section about automatic reindexing in the documentation


  Commit: a6319364a754836530725e226d20cb37c64c52d6
      https://github.com/hibernate/hibernate-search/commit/a6319364a754836530725e226d20cb37c64c52d6
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/includepaths/Human.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/includepaths/IndexedEmbeddedIncludePathsI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/includepathsanddepth/Human.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/includepathsanddepth/IndexedEmbeddedIncludePathsAndDepthI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/none/Author.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/none/Book.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/none/IndexedEmbeddedNoneI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/onelevel/Author.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/onelevel/Book.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/onelevel/IndexedEmbeddedOneLevelI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/twolevels/Address.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/twolevels/Author.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/twolevels/Book.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/indexedembedded/twolevels/IndexedEmbeddedTwoLevelsIT.java
    M mapper/pojo/src/main/java/org/hibernate/search/mapper/pojo/mapping/definition/annotation/IndexedEmbedded.java

  Log Message:
  -----------
  HSEARCH-3673 Document @IndexedEmbedded


  Commit: 418176c0e8e55e8c44bcf6e5a77a9d1f90b2ffb8
      https://github.com/hibernate/hibernate-search/commit/418176c0e8e55e8c44bcf6e5a77a9d1f90b2ffb8
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/containerextractor/Author.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/containerextractor/Book.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/containerextractor/BookFormat.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/containerextractor/ContainerExtractorI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/containerextractor/MyCollectionSizeBridge.java

  Log Message:
  -----------
  HSEARCH-3679 Document container extractors


  Commit: 96141f374438a67880dd48de52d21fc60ce3995f
      https://github.com/hibernate/hibernate-search/commit/96141f374438a67880dd48de52d21fc60ce3995f
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    R integrationtest/mapper/orm/src/test/java/org/hibernate/search/integrationtest/mapper/orm/smoke/bridge/OptionalIntAsStringValueBridge.java
    R integrationtest/mapper/orm/src/test/java/org/hibernate/search/integrationtest/mapper/orm/smoke/usertype/OptionalIntUserType.java
    R integrationtest/mapper/orm/src/test/java/org/hibernate/search/integrationtest/mapper/orm/smoke/usertype/OptionalStringUserType.java
    R integrationtest/mapper/pojo/src/test/java/org/hibernate/search/integrationtest/mapper/pojo/smoke/bridge/OptionalIntAsStringValueBridge.java

  Log Message:
  -----------
  HSEARCH-3676 Remove a few unused classes in tests


  Commit: 450b77f1d48499afed4f384b2e52e7dc4e466f26
      https://github.com/hibernate/hibernate-search/commit/450b77f1d48499afed4f384b2e52e7dc4e466f26
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c

  Log Message:
  -----------
  HSEARCH-3676 Avoid the confusing "direct field mapping" terminology


  Commit: 2794fa38ebafaeaf2bdff8514ea701f158fc6723
      https://github.com/hibernate/hibernate-search/commit/2794fa38ebafaeaf2bdff8514ea701f158fc6723
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c

  Log Message:
  -----------
  HSEARCH-3676 Remove obsolete TODOs in @*Field documentation


  Commit: cc35ffa222798d7b41cd790714a772361a9a6c4d
      https://github.com/hibernate/hibernate-search/commit/cc35ffa222798d7b41cd790714a772361a9a6c4d
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/identifiermapping/customtype/Book.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/identifiermapping/customtype/ISBN.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/identifiermapping/customtype/ISBNIdentifierBridge.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/identifiermapping/customtype/ISBNUserType.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/identifiermapping/customtype/IdentifierMappingCustomTypeI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/identifiermapping/naturalid/Book.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/identifiermapping/naturalid/IdentifierMappingNaturalIdIT.java

  Log Message:
  -----------
  HSEARCH-3676 Document identifier mapping


  Commit: ce635ab4918d237c6e6fdff38f10e2016acdd067
      https://github.com/hibernate/hibernate-search/commit/ce635ab4918d237c6e6fdff38f10e2016acdd067
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/backend-elasticsearch.asciidoc
    M documentation/src/main/asciidoc/backend-lucene.asciidoc
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c

  Log Message:
  -----------
  HSEARCH-3676 Move the lists of supported property types from the "Bridges" documentation to the "Mapping" documentation

This will make documenting bridges easier, as we will directly assume
that the reader wants to implement a custom bridge.


  Commit: 08e79070a0d12df1e3111dabfb430f49e34dbef4
      https://github.com/hibernate/hibernate-search/commit/08e79070a0d12df1e3111dabfb430f49e34dbef4
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c

  Log Message:
  -----------
  HSEARCH-3676 Move the warning about legacy date/time types from the "Bridges" documentation to the "Mapping" documentation

For consistency with the lists of supported types, which moved there
too.


  Commit: 818066309060bc03a50e5adaa782de1c8ad535e0
      https://github.com/hibernate/hibernate-search/commit/818066309060bc03a50e5adaa782de1c8ad535e0
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c

  Log Message:
  -----------
  HSEARCH-3676 Remove obsolete TODOs in the mapping documentation


  Commit: 64c30b4f72765d565786c51d92e93a8eb8c3e82e
      https://github.com/hibernate/hibernate-search/commit/64c30b4f72765d565786c51d92e93a8eb8c3e82e
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/mappingconfigurer/Book.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/mappingconfigurer/MappingConfigurerI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/mappingconfigurer/MySearchMappingConfigurer.java

  Log Message:
  -----------
  HSEARCH-3676 Add an example to the documentation for the mapping configurer


  Commit: 475d21a79237b373af84443f8466a708665093e4
      https://github.com/hibernate/hibernate-search/commit/475d21a79237b373af84443f8466a708665093e4
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c

  Log Message:
  -----------
  HSEARCH-3676 Move the "bridges" section to a more appropriate position in the documentation

It's really about custom bridges, thus is a fairly advanced topic and
should be near the end.


  Commit: 874a7e063e32a4ea60eb6d075f062f646eb5d896
      https://github.com/hibernate/hibernate-search/commit/874a7e063e32a4ea60eb6d075f062f646eb5d896
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c

  Log Message:
  -----------
  HSEARCH-3676 Move the "mapping spatial types" section to a more appropriate position in the documentation

It's not simply property/field mapping, so it deserves its own section.


  Commit: 732908acdbd881d60f18da078e8adcde0bd9d5c4
      https://github.com/hibernate/hibernate-search/commit/732908acdbd881d60f18da078e8adcde0bd9d5c4
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/spatial/genericfield/Author.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/spatial/genericfield/GeoPointGenericFieldI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/spatial/genericfield/MyCoordinates.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/spatial/geopointbinding/multiple/Author.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/spatial/geopointbinding/multiple/GeoPointBindingMultipleI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/spatial/geopointbinding/property/Author.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/spatial/geopointbinding/property/GeoPointBindingPropertyI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/spatial/geopointbinding/property/MyCoordinates.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/spatial/geopointbinding/type/Author.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/spatial/geopointbinding/type/GeoPointBindingTypeIT.java

  Log Message:
  -----------
  HSEARCH-3676 Document mapping of geo-points


  Commit: f7d3a81423318c08382fb5eada1bd3b6c2e8a091
      https://github.com/hibernate/hibernate-search/commit/f7d3a81423318c08382fb5eada1bd3b6c2e8a091
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/reindexing/associationinverseside/AssociationInverseSideI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/reindexing/associationinverseside/Book.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/reindexing/associationinverseside/BookEdition.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/reindexing/derivedfrom/Book.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/reindexing/derivedfrom/DerivedFromIT.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/reindexing/reindexonupdate/Book.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/reindexing/reindexonupdate/BookCategory.java
    A documentation/src/test/java/org/hibernate/search/documentation/mapper/orm/reindexing/reindexonupdate/ReindexOnUpdateIT.java
    M mapper/pojo/src/main/java/org/hibernate/search/mapper/pojo/mapping/definition/annotation/AssociationInverseSide.java

  Log Message:
  -----------
  HSEARCH-3676 Document tuning of automatic reindexing


  Commit: 81968152310ad6f6de4f271e92a8b01972876fde
      https://github.com/hibernate/hibernate-search/commit/81968152310ad6f6de4f271e92a8b01972876fde
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-indexing-explicit.asciidoc
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c

  Log Message:
  -----------
  HSEARCH-3676 Document how to handle mapping changes


  Commit: a8658f3c12f2df8bc1c2d09b351122409c7a6008
      https://github.com/hibernate/hibernate-search/commit/a8658f3c12f2df8bc1c2d09b351122409c7a6008
  Author: Yoann Rodière <yoann at hibernate.org>
  Date:   2019-09-13 (Fri, 13 Sep 2019)

  Changed paths:
    M documentation/src/main/asciidoc/mapper-orm-mapping.asciidoc

  Log Message:
  -----------
  HSEARCH-3676 Fix invalid references to the source code in the documentation


Compare: https://github.com/hibernate/hibernate-search/compare/d2a435fff5a2...a8658f3c12f2



More information about the hibernate-commits mailing list